Didier Puzenat   
Nom et prénom : PUZENAT Didier
Adresse postale : Institut de la communication (ICOM)
  Université Lumière Lyon 2
  Campus Porte des Alpes, 5 avenue Pierre Mendès France, 69 676 Bron Cedex
Téléphone (UAG) : 04 78 77 23 91 (bureau à l'ICOM)
Courriel : didier.puzenat à liris.cnrs.fr
Laboratoire : LIRIS
Équipe : DRIM «  Distribution, Recherche d'Information et Mobilité »


Table des matières


Recherche

Ma recherche historique porte sur deux thèmes, et notamment sur leur intersection ; le connexionnisme (les réseaux de neurones artificiels) et le parallélisme. Ainsi j'ai beaucoup travaillé sur l'apprentissage de réseaux de neurones dans des environnements distribués. Une partie de cette recherche relève des sciences cognitives. Enfin, depuis quelques années je travaille sur l'analyse du comportement par l'instrumentation d'interfaces homme-machine, et notamment par le jeu vidéo, avec des applications concrètes à moyen terme dans le domaine de l'e-santé. Depuis mon intégration dans DRIM je travaille plus particulièrement sur la collecte décentralisée et sécurisée des données nécessaires à mes systèmes apprenants, toujours dans le cadre de l'analyse du comportement.


Publications


Mémoires

[1]  « Vers un modèle connexionniste multimodal de la mémoire humaine »
Habilitation à Diriger des Recherches en Informatique de l'Université Lyon 2
soutenue le 15/12/2003 à l'Institut des Sciences Cognitives.

[2]  « Parallélisme et modularité des modèles connexionnistes »
Thèse en informatique de l'École Normale Supérieure de Lyon
soutenue le 20/10/1997 à l'ENS Lyon
URL : ftp://ftp.ens-lyon.fr/pub/LIP/Rapports/PhD/PhD1997/PhD1997-08.ps.Z.


Revues

[3]  « A computational model for binding sensory modalities »
E. Reynaud, A. Crépet, H. Paugam-Moisy et D. Puzenat
Résumé paru dans « Consciousness and Cognition », volume 9 (2), pages 87 et 88, juin 2000, Elsevier Science / Academic Press.

[4]  « A scalable parallel algorithm for training a hierarchical mixture of neural experts »
P. Estévez, H. Paugam-Moisy, D. Puzenat et M. Ugarte
Article paru dans « Parallel Computing », volume 28 (6), pages 861 à 891, 2002, Elsevier Science.

[5]  « Perception of dynamic action in patients with schizophrenia »
T. Zalla, I. Verlut, N. Franck, D. Puzenat et A. Sirigu.
Article paru dans « Psychiatry Research », volume 128, pages 39 à 51, 2004, Elsevier Science.

[6]  « Levels-of-processing effects on a task of olfactory »
J.-P. Royet, O. Koenig, H. Paugam-Moisy, D. Puzenat et J.-L. Chassé
Article paru dans « Perceptual and Motor Skills », volume 98, pages 197 à 213, 2004.

[7]  « Alcohol consumption detection through behavioural analysis using intelligent systems »
A. Robinel et D. Puzenat
Article paru dans « Expert Systems with Applications », numéro 41, pages 2574 à 2581, 2013.


Conférences internationales

[8]  « An incremental neural classifier on a MIMD parallel computer »
A. Azcarraga, H. Paugam-Moisy et D. Puzenat
Article paru dans « Applications in Parallel and Distributed Computing », édité par C. Girault, volume A-44 des « IFIP Transactions », pages 13 à 22, Caracas, avril 1994 (ISBN 0926-5473).

[9]  « Priming an artificial neural classifier »
D. Puzenat
Article paru dans « From Natural to Artificial Neural Computation », édité par J. Mira et F. Sandoval, volume 930 des « Lecture Notes in Computer Science », pages 559 à 565, et présenté à « International Work Conference on Artificial Neural Networks (IWANN'95) », Málaga, juin 1995 (ISBN 3-540-59497-3).

[10]  « An asynchronous parallelization of an artificial neural network on a parallel virtual machine »
D. Puzenat
Article paru dans les actes du « 11th Annual International Symposium on High Performance Computing (HPCS'97) », pages 73 à 82, Winnipeg, juillet 1997.

[11]  « Modular parallel implementation for HME neural networks »
P.A. Estevez, H. Paugam-Moisy, D. Puzenat et M. Ugarte
Article paru dans les actes de « International Conference on Parallel and Distributed Processing Techniques and Applications (PDPTA'98) », édité par H.R. Arabnia, pages 1365 à 1372, Las Vegas, juillet 1998.

[12]  « Levels-of-processing effects on olfactory naming »
J.P. Royet, O. Koenig, H. Paugam-Moisy, D. Zighed, D. Puzenat, M. Sebban, M. Vigouroux et J.L. Chassé
Article paru dans les actes du congrès « Ecro XIII », Sienne, septembre 1998.

[13]  « Priming an artificial associative memory »
C. Bertolini, H. Paugam-Moisy et D. Puzenat
Article paru dans « Foundations and tools for neural modeling », édité par J. Mira et J.V. Sanchez-Andres, volume 1606 des « Lecture Notes in Computer Science », pages 348 à 356, et présenté à « International Work Conference on Artificial Neural Networks (IWANN'99) », Alicante, juin 1999 (ISBN 3-540-66069-0).

[14]  « Classifiers with low decision-making error using linear combination of functions »
G. Gavin, D. Puzenat et D. Zighed
Article paru dans les actes de « International Conference on Artificial Intelligence (ICAI'99) », pages 226 à 232, Las Vegas, juin 1999.

[15]  « A modular neural network model for a multimodal associative memory »
E. Reynaud, A. Crépet, H. Paugam-Moisy et D. Puzenat
Article paru dans les actes de « International Conference on Cognitive and Neural Systems (ICCNS'2000) », page 17, Boston, mai 2000.

[16]  « A modular neural network for binding several modalities »
A. Crépet, H. Paugam-Moisy, E. Reynaud et D. Puzenat
Article paru dans les actes de « International Conference of Artificial Intelligence (ICAI'2000) », pages 921 à 928, Las Vegas, juin 2000 (ISBN 1-892512-57-2).

[17]  « New mesh generating adapted to parallel systems: PVM implementation issue »
A. Doncescu et D. Puzenat
Article paru dans les « Proceedings of the 2000 International Workshop on Parallel Processing », pages 243 à 250, Toronto, août 2000.

[18]  « A computational model for binding sensory modalities »
E. Reynaud, A. Crépet, H. Paugam-Moisy et D. Puzenat
Article paru dans les actes des « fourth conference of the Association for the Scientific Study of Consciousness (ASSC4) », Bruxelles, juin 2000. Résumé paru dans [3].

[19]  « A multisensory identification system for robotics »
E. Reynaud et D. Puzenat
Article paru dans les actes de « International Conference on Neural Networks (IJCNN'2001) », pages 2924 à 2929, Washington DC, juillet 2001.

[20]  « Neural networks for modelling memory : case studies »
H. Paugam-Moisy, D. Puzenat, E. Reynaud et J.-P. Magué
Article paru dans les actes de « 10th European Symposium on Artificial Neural Networks (ESANN'2002) », pages 71 à 81, Bruges, avril 2002.

[21]  « Influence of emotions on cognition, a study based on neural networks synchronization »
D. Puzenat et C. Gattet
Article paru dans les actes de la seconde « IASTED International Conference Artificial Intelligence and Applications (ICAIA'02) », pages 17 à 21, Málaga, septembre 2002 (ISBN 0-88986-352-0).

[22]  « Asynchrony in a distributed modular neural network for multimodal integration »
Y. Bouchut, H. Paugam-Moisy et D. Puzenat
Article puru dans les actes de « IASTED International Conference on Parallel and Distributed Computing and Systems (PDCS'03) », pages 588 à 593, Marina del Rey, novembre 2003 (ISBN 0-88986-392-X). Article nominé « best paper ».

[23] «  DAMNED: A Distributed And Multithreaded Neural Event Driven simulation framework »
A. Mouraud, H. Paugam-Moisy et D. Puzenat
Article paru dans les actes de « IASTED Parallel and Distributed Computing and Networks (PDCN'06) », pages 212 à 217, Innsbruck, février 2006.

[24]  « Distributed simulations of spiking neural networks »
A. Mouraud et D. Puzenat
Article présenté à l'occasion d'un workshop dans le cadre de « 11th International Conference On Principles Of Distributed Systems (OPODIS'07) », Pointe-à-Pitre, décembre 2007.

[25]  « Simulation of large spiking neural networks on distributed architectures, The "DAMNED" Simulator »
A. Mouraud et D. Puzenat
Article paru dans les actes de « The 11th International Conference on Engineering Applications of Neural Networks (EANN'09) », CCIS 43, pages 359 à 370, Londres, août 2009.

[26]  « Behavior analysis through games using artificial neural networks »
D. Puzenat et I. Verlut
Article paru dans les actes de la « Third International Conferences on Advances in Computer-Human Interactions (ACHI'10) », pages 134 à 138, Sint Maarten, Netherlands, février 2010. Cet article a été élu «best paper » de la conférence.


Conférences nationales

[27]  « Apprentissage parallèle d'un réseau neuronal incrémental »
D. Puzenat
Article paru dans les actes du « Premier Colloque Jeunes Chercheurs en Sciences Cognitives (CJC'94) », page 280, La Motte d'Aveillans, mars 1994.

[28]  « Traitement cognitif des odeurs : analyse de données expérimentales »
R. Baron, R. Eberhardt, H. Paugam-Moisy, D. Puzenat et J.-P. Royet
Neuvièmes Journées « Neurosciences et Sciences de l'Ingénieur (NSI'98) », pages 37 à 41, Munster, mai 1998.

[29]  « Amorçage d'une mémoire associative artificielle »
C. Bertolini, H. Paugam-Moisy et D. Puzenat
Article paru dans les actes du « Troisième Colloque Jeunes Chercheurs en Sciences Cognitives (CJC'99) », pages 18 à 24, Soulac, avril 1999.

[30]  « Vers un modèle de mémoire associative multimodale »
E. Reynaud, H. Paugam-Moisy et D. Puzenat
Article paru dans les actes du « Troisième Colloque Jeunes Chercheurs en Sciences Cognitives (CJC'99) », pages 195 à 203, Soulac, avril 1999.

[31]  « Mémoire associative multimodale et mécanismes de retour de l'information pour la discrimination »
A. Crépet, H. Paugam-Moisy, D. Puzenat et E. Reynaud
Article paru dans les actes de la « Conférence d'Apprentissage (CAp'2000) », page 69, Paris, juin 2000.


Conférences chiliennes

[32]  « Classification of rocks using a MIMD parallel computer or a network of wokstations »
D. Puzenat
Conférence « Infonor'97 », Antofagasta, Chili, octobre 1997.

[33]  « Parallel simulation of modular neural networks »
P. Estévez, M. Ugarte, H. Paugam-Moisy et D. Puzenat
XIIe congrès chilien d'ingénierie électrique, Temuco, Chili, novembre 1997.


Manifestations nationales sans comité de lecture

[34]  « Parallélisme et réseaux neuronaux »
H. Paugam-Moisy et D. Puzenat
Deuxième réunion de l'AFCET, AFIA Apprentissage automatique, Grenoble, avril 1995.

[35]  « Modélisation des processus de mémorisation »
H. Paugam-Moisy et D. Puzenat
Colloque du Pôle Rhône-Alpes de Sciences Cognitives, Glion-sur-Montreux, mai 1997.

[36]  « Introduction à la parallélisation d'applications »
D. Puzenat
Journées d'Études et de Recherche Antilles Guyane (JERAG'08), Pointe-à-Pitre, février 2008.

Rapports de recherche

[37]  « An incremental neural classifier on a MIMD computer »
A. Azcarraga, H. Paugam-Moisy et D. Puzenat
Rapport de recherche RR-9340 du Laboratoire de l'Informatique du Parallélisme, décembre 1993 (version étendue de [8]).

[38]  « Priming an artificial neural classifier »
D. Puzenat
Rapport de recherche RR-9510 du Laboratoire de l'Informatique du Parallélisme, avril 1995 (preprint de [9]).

[39]  « Is it possible to discriminate odors with common words ? »
R. Eberhardt, H. Paugam-Moisy, D. Puzenat et J.P. Royet
Rapport de recherche RR-9531 du Laboratoire de l'Informatique du Parallélisme, novembre 1995. Rapport complémentaire de [12].

[40]  « Amorçage d'une mémoire associative artificielle »
C. Bertolini, D. Puzenat et H. Paugam-Moisy
Rapport de recherche RR-9903 du laboratoire d'informatique ERIC, mars 1999 (preprint de [29]).

[41]  « Vers un modèle de mémoire associative multimodale »
H. Paugam-Moisy, D. Puzenat et E. Reynaud. . Rapport de recherche RR-9904 du laboratoire d'informatique ERIC, mars 1999 (preprint de [30]).

[42]  « Classifiers with low decision-making error using linear combination of functions »
G. Gavin, D. Puzenat et D. Zighed
Rapport de recherche RR-9905 du laboratoire d'informatique ERIC, avril 1999 (preprint de [14]).


Logiciels

Les six logiciels présentés ici ont la particularité d'être sortis de mon laboratoire et d'avoir été utilisés par d'autres chercheurs lors d'importants projets.

[43] Interface d'expérimentation Dans le cadre d'une collaboration entre laboratoires lyonnais, j'ai développé une « interface d'acquisition de données ». Ce logiciel permet la gestion d'expériences dans le domaine de l'olfaction humaine : minutage, présentation des consignes, pilotage d'un « stimulateur olfactif » et d'un écran tactile... Les contraintes de temps réel, ainsi que la nécessité d'un accès « bas niveau » à l'horloge de l'ordinateur pour une mesure précise du temps, ont conduit à écrire une interface graphique dédiée. L'utilisation de ce programme a permis de nombreuses expériences qui ont conduit à plusieurs publications [2, 6, 12, 28, 39].

[44] Classifieur incrémental parallèle Ce logiciel est un classifieur parallèle basé sur un classifieur séquentiel développé au LIFIA en 1991. La stratégie de parallélisation est issue de mes travaux de thèse. Le programme peut directement être utilisé sur une grande variété de plate-formes, aussi bien une machine séquentielle qu'un réseau de stations ou une machine parallèle. Dans le cas d'une utilisation distribuée, le programme est tolérant aux pannes. Ce logiciel a été exploité dans le cadre d'un programme minier chilien (voir projet « Paralin »). Le principe et l'utilisation du programme sont détaillés dans les documents déjà cités [2, 8, 10, 27, 32, 37].

[45] Classifieur par mixture d'experts Le logiciel le plus technique auquel j'ai travaillé est sans nul doute le classifieur neuronal par mixture d'experts, fruit d'une collaboration franco-chilienne. Ce logiciel a été développé lors de mon post-doctorat au département de mathématiques de l'Université du Chili avec l'aide d'un stagiaire nommé Manuel Ugarte. Le travail a continué après mon post-doctorat, par courrier électronique et par des séjours de travail. La version actuelle du logiciel fonctionne sur une machine séquentielle, un réseau de stations, ainsi que sur la machine parallèle Capitan (Matra). Les différents aspects techniques et théoriques de ce travail ont été présentés lors de plusieurs conférences [11, 33] et dans une revue [4].

[46] Classifieur multimodal Le logiciel issu de la recherche présentée dans mon HDR est un classifieur multimodal basé sur une modélisation de la mémoire humaine. Le développement a commencé à l'Institut des Sciences Cognitives puis a continué par l'encadrement de stagiaires à distance et lors de visites, puis en collaboration avec une étudiante en thèse de mon équipe à l'ISC. Le logiciel traite séparément chaque modalité grâce à des classifieurs incrémentaux [43]. Un module dit associatif se charge de donner une réponse globale en « fusionnant » les sources. Les étapes significatives de ce travail ont été régulièrement publiées [3, 15, 16, 30, 31]. Une version du logiciel dédiée à la robotique a également été implémentée [19], ainsi qu'une version parallèle et asynchrone [22].

[47] Simulateur DAMNED Le simulateur DAMNED (acronyme de A Distributed And Multithreaded Neural Event Driven simulation framework) est issu des recherches effectuées dans le cadre de la thèse d'Anthony Mouraud. Ce logiciel est un simulateur de réseau de neurones impulsionels basé sur une approche événementielle et dédié à toutes machines de type MIMD à mémoire distribuée. Le traitement réalisé sur chaque n\oeud est fortement multi-threadé afin de profiter pleinement des processeurs multi-corps actuels. Ce simulateur a été testé sur une machine parallèle et sur une grappe de calcul, et a déjà été présenté lors de plusieurs conférences [23, 24, 25]. Le simulateur a été mis en \oeuvre en 2009 par Anthony Mouraud pour la simulation de saccades oculaires afin de démontrer son efficacité.

[48] Outil d'aide au diagnostic à l'usage des neuropsychologues Une batterie de jeux vidéo a été instrumentée afin de mesurer les performances du sujet. Un modèle connexioniste permet d'évaluer le joueur sur un critère précis suite à un apprentissage sur une population représentative. Ce travail a été présenté en conférence en février 2010 [26]. Le logiciel est utilisé de façon expérimentale au CHU de la Guadeloupe.


Curriculum Vitæ


Comités scientifiques permanents


Enseignement en 2016 / 2017



Didier Puzenat 2010-06-05